I applied through an employee referral. The process took 3 weeks. I interviewed at Justworks (New York, NY) in July 2023
Interview
First there is an intital phone screening, then the second round is a brief writing assignment that is straightforward and doesn't take too long, the last round is three different interviews with three different people including a sales role play
I applied online. The process took 2 weeks. I interviewed at Justworks
Interview
3 rounds of interviews with 3 different managers, including one role play. If they like you after the 3 initial interviews then there is a 4th interview which is chill and is just a culture fit.
